CNN anchor Jessica Dean is pregnant with her first child, a boy, due in June 2026. The 41-year-old journalist reveals how she came to terms with motherhood later in life and why her age feels “right on time.”

CNN's Jessica Dean Is Pregnant, Expecting Her First Baby with Husband Alex Katz (Exclusive)

CNN anchor Jessica Dean is expecting her first baby, a boy, due in June 2026, with husband Alex Katz, a detail confirmed by People. The couple, who married in June 2024, shared the news exclusively.

“If I’m being honest, it hasn’t really felt real until…now,” Dean told People. “Telling our friends and family was very sweet. Funny enough, I think I would have waited until it was almost too late to tell everyone while Alex was bursting at the seams from the day we found out.”

“I’ve been extremely lucky and have felt relatively good so far,” she continued. “The sickest I remember being was around six weeks. I filled in on the morning edition of CNN News Central, which airs from 7-10 a.m., so I woke up very early that day.” Dean remembers eating every snack she could find during commercial breaks to try to cure herself of the waves of nausea.

“I’ve been very into fruit — at the beginning, I remember eating an apple and thinking this is the greatest apple, the most perfect thing I’ve ever tasted,” she says. “I’m pretty sure it was just an average apple, but something about pregnancy has made all fruit perfect to me.”

“I’ve been focused on staying active — being in New York City, I’m walking every day, and I’m still doing the Tracy Anderson Method with some modifications. That movement helps me keep sane and feeling like myself.”

The soon-to-be parents have already discussed names and even have one picked out. “We have the name. Alex actually came up with it before I was pregnant, and the more we talked about it, the more it felt like we can’t name this child anything else; this is it,” says Dean.

“I came to this later in life, at the age of 41, which, while it sounds cliché, feels right on time for me,” she says. “Before Alex and I started dating, I had made peace with the idea [that] children may not be in the cards for me.”

“When Alex and I got married in June 2024, my heart was so full. It was truly content. To be able to build a family together is a dream I think I’d quietly let go of years ago that is now coming true,” continues Dean. “It’s the sweetest cherry on top.”

Dean explains that she’s “always been a planner” and loves to be in control, but acknowledges that those two qualities might not be the best for a baby. “At 41, I’m far more comfortable letting go of expectations than I think I would have been ten years ago. I can’t wait to experience all of it in full, even the chaos and hard parts,” she says.

“Of course, every pregnancy and person is different, but I’ve really found my age to be an asset in this whole process. At 41, I really know myself, I know my weaknesses and strengths, what’s actually worth worrying about and what’s not. That wisdom has been invaluable and something I’ve relied on again and again.”

One of the most special parts of this pregnancy for Dean has been having her little one with her for some of the biggest breaking news moments from the last year. “I solo anchor 3 straight hours, sometimes more, every Saturday and Sunday, and from his earliest days, this baby has been right there with me for some of the biggest breaking news of the last six months — sometimes 4 plus hours of rolling coverage,” says Dean. “We catch a tremendous amount of news on the weekends, and he seems to like it as much as I do. I feel him kicking and rolling from the opening show music and throughout the interviews.”

The mom-to-be adds that being on TV while pregnant has been an “interesting experience.” “Anyone who’s been pregnant knows the question of ‘what am I going to wear’ becomes a bit more complicated, especially during that in-between phase when you don’t look fully pregnant but also don’t look like your normal self,” says Dean. “Thankfully, drawstring and elastic waistband pants are very in right now. I’ve practically lived in the La Ligne Colby pant (bless them, they make a zillion colors).”

Key Facts at a Glance

  • Who: CNN anchor Jessica Dean, 41, and husband Alex Katz
  • What: Expecting first child, a boy
  • Due: June 2026
  • Married: June 2024
  • Work: Dean continues anchoring CNN News Central on weekends
  • Age perspective: Dean says 41 feels “right on time” and that her age brings valuable wisdom
